Mesopotamia is credited with the invention of writing and of agriculture, and so is seen as the cradle of civilisation . The dazzling quality of the art of the Sumerians, Akkadian. Hittite, Assyrian and Persian empires speaks to the present about the culture and belief systems of these peoples. The text covers the origins of the cities and empires concerned, their view of the gods and the evolution of writing, including a special feature on the epic of Gilgamesh.
